Job Description Professional Experience description: Ensure effective control of plant operating parameters within the control limits with prompt analysis of trends & assignable causes to meet quality requirements of Power Plant operating parameters. Preparation of annual budget and monitoring the expenditure as per plan Ensure consistent steam and power output by continually monitoring parameters. Supervise day to day TPP operation activity and Interact with TPP Maintenance (Mech & EI) department for the day to day operational related activity. Ensure entry & History in SAP as well as various KPI reports To ensure full compliance to safety in all respect for all maintenance jobs for all standards by developing and sustaining safety culture at site through various means. To achieve the target of zero harm and injury incident on sustainable basis through effective safety practice and developing environment for the same at workplace Good coordination shift team members & cross function team member. Ensure consistent steam and power output by continually monitoring parameters. Critical Job competencies / Mandatory Skills: 1. Experience of field and desk operating of boilers and turbine during normal and emergency time, safe start-up and stoppage of plant, like to come in round the clock shifts. 2. Sound knowledge in CFBC and AFBC/WHRS Boilers, Steam turbines, Water chemistry and material handling system (Ash and Coal handling plant) operation. Shift operations through DCS and ensuring field observations & safe controls 3. Coordination of inter functional activities and collaboration with other functional task for TPP Shift process 4. Basic knowledge of SAP & TM1 and entry daily power reports in SAP. 5. Demonstrate the safety and ensuring safety in work place with compliance of organisation's audits and reports. 6. Ensuring work area basic conditions 5S, Enhance Equipment reliability with OEE and adopting WCM culture/ tools Professional Qualifications: Diploma/BE/B Tech Mechanical Essential: Experience in TPP Desk Operation specially with AFBC/CFBC / WHRS Preferably: BOE with Energy Manager/NPTI
